Brampton Local drop-in session
Published at 18:00, Sunday, 29 April 2012
If you would like to know more about the Brampton Local website then come along to the Howard Arms on Wednesday for our first drop-in session.
You can meet the people behind the site and find out how to promote your group or event for free on Brampton Local. We'll set you up a free page on the spot.
Or if you are a business we can tell you about how the site is developing and promoting local firns with low cost advertising options.
So drop by for a chat - we'll also be happy to give you some advice about using Twitter, Facebook and other social media.
The drop in session will run from 1pm to 3pm in the Howard Arms, Front Street, Brampton, on Wednesday May 2nd. Drop by whenever you are free - we'll be holding more sessions soon including some in the evening.
